For my card, I started by creating my background panel. You would think that based on the huge collection of patterned papers in my stash that I wouldn't have to create my own background paper. However, it's so fun. I started with a panel of 100 lb bristol and distress inks - wilted violet, cracked pistachio, mermaid lagoon. I smooshed the ink on a plastic place mat, spritzed a bit of water and picked up the ink with a piece of acetate packaging. I added one color at a time and continued until I was happy with the result. I let the panel dry. Once dry, I die cut it with a My Favorite Things' Stitched Square STAX die. I die cut the sprig using Memory Box's Large Olive Branch die and some silver cardstock and glued it to the smooshed panel, trimming the excess. For the sentiment, I used Clearly Besotted's A Little Sentimental with silver embossing powder on a white A2 card base. To complete my card, I adhered the watercolor panel to the card base with double-sided tape.

For my card, I masked off a frame, leaving the central area. I ink blended in the central area with picked raspberry distress ink, applied with an oval ink blending brush. I removed the mask and with a dry brush, added Perfect Pearls - perfect pearls all over the inked area. The Perfect Pearls adheres to the "wet" inked area. I then used a Spellbinders' Embossing Folder of the Month - EOM Dec 2022 called Heart Blooms. I created a sentiment strip on red cardstock using CTMH's Say It All Stampaganza 2017 stamp set and silver embossing powder. I cut the sentiment strip equal to the width of the pink area and adhered it in place. To complete my card, I adhered the panel to a white A2 card base with double-sided tape.
